What this issue is
NAP (Name, Address, Phone) consistency is a core local ranking factor. Search engines cross-reference your NAP across the web, and missing pieces reduce trust.
Why it matters
NAP (Name, Address, Phone) consistency is a core local ranking factor. Search engines cross-reference your NAP across the web, and missing pieces reduce trust. This affects local visibility and whether nearby customers can quickly confirm you serve their area.

How to fix it
- 1Display your full business name, street address, and phone number on every page (footer is ideal)
- 2Use consistent formatting across all pages and directory listings
- 3Add LocalBusiness schema with complete address details
How to re-check it
- Confirm NAP is visible in footer or header and matches your Google Business Profile
